Key Responsibilities
- Collaborate with patients, families, and staff to address and resolve issues during visits.
- Communicate any expected delays to patients and ancillary service departments.
- Greet, escort, and manage phone calls while ensuring excellent guest relations.
- Maintain the appearance of waiting areas, reception, and offices.
- Request, prepare, and verify the completeness of patient medical records and physician orders.
- Conduct patient check-in, check-out, scheduling, cancellation, and no-show management.
- Validate patient demographics, insurance details, pre-certification, referrals, and manage copay collections.
- Prepare patients for examinations and perform Point of Care testing as applicable.
